Encyclopedias are a type of book that contain a comprehensive collection of information on a particular subject. They are typically organized in alphabetical order and can be used as a reference source. In recent years, encyclopedias have been made available in digital formats, such as ebooks. This has allowed for easier access to the information contained within them, as well as the ability to search for specific topics.
Encyclopedias are often used by students, researchers, and professionals to gain a better understanding of a particular subject. They can also be used as a source of entertainment, as they often contain interesting facts and stories.
The encyclopedia market is highly competitive, with a variety of publishers offering different types of encyclopedias. Some of the most popular publishers include Britannica, Oxford University Press, and Cambridge University Press.
